Background: CA125 is a high molecular weight glycoprotein, which is expressed by a large proportion of epithelial ovarian cancers. The sensitivity and specificity of CA125 are poor and there are no guidelines produced by the Royal College of Pathologists or the Association of Clinical Biochemists to aid clinicians and laboratories in its most appropriate use. Aim: To identify the patient population having a CA125 measurement and to determine its contribution to individual patient management. Methods: A retrospective case note audit looking at patients who had a CA125 measurement performed between April 2000 and April 2002. Results: The study comprised 799 patients; 751 (94%) were female and 48 (6%) male; 221 (29%) females and 22 (46%) males had an abnormal result. CA125 was mainly used to investigate a wide range of signs and symptoms, and few tests were for follow up or screening of ovarian cancer. In female patients having a CA125 for suspicion of malignancy/ovarian cancer, only 39 (20%) of the abnormal results were caused by ovarian cancer. False positive results were largely caused by another malignancy (48 cases; 26%), benign ovarian disease (26 cases; 14%), and benign gynaecological conditions, particularly leiomyomas (18 cases; 9%). The specificity of CA125 for ovarian cancer increased with concentrations .1000 kU/ litre. Conclusions: These results confirm the high false positive rate and poor sensitivity and specificity associated with CA125. The substantial inappropriate usage of CA125 has led to results that are useless to the clinician, have cost implications, and add to patient anxiety and clinical uncertainty.
BackgroundThe human papillomavirus (HPV) vaccine is recommended for adolescent girls in many European countries, however there is huge variation in vaccine uptake. Methods A mixed methods systematic review to ascertain the level of HPV and HPV vaccine knowledge that exists among European adolescents. Two electronic databases, Ovid Medline and PsychInfo, were searched from origin to September 2014. Meta-analysis was performed for the two primary outcome measures ('have you heard of HPV?' and 'have you heard of the HPV vaccine?'), assessing for the correlation between gender and knowledge. This was supplemented with meta-synthesis for the remaining associations and secondary outcomes. Results 18 papers were included in the final review. Overall European adolescents had poor understanding of basic HPV and HPV vaccine knowledge. Meta-analysis identified that female adolescents are more likely to have heard of HPV (n=2598/5028 girls versus n=1033/3464 boys; OR 2.73, 95% CI 1.86-3.99) and the HPV vaccine (n=1154/2556 girls versus n=392/2074 boys; OR 5.64, 95% CI 2.43-13.07), compared to males. Age, higher education and a positive vaccination status were also associated with increased awareness. There was limited appreciation of more detailed HPV knowledge and uncertainty existed regarding the level of protection offered by the vaccine and the need for cervical screening post vaccination. Conclusions The delivery of HPV education to European adolescents needs to be re-evaluated, since at present there appears to be significant deficiencies in their basic knowledge and understanding of the subject. Increasing HPV knowledge will empower adolescents to make informed choices regarding participation with HPV related cancer prevention health strategies.
Background The colposcopy-directed punch biopsy is widely used in the management of women with abnormal cervical cytology; however, its accuracy compared with definitive histology from an excision biopsy is not well established.Objectives To assess the accuracy of the colposcopy-directed punch biopsy to diagnose high-grade cervical intraepithelial neoplasia (CIN) by performing a systematic review and meta-analysis.Search strategy A systematic search of MEDLINE, EMBASE and the Cochrane Library was performed.Selection criteria Articles that compared the colposcopically directed cervical punch biopsy with definitive histology from an excisional cervical biopsy or hysterectomy.Data collection and analysis Random effects and hierarchical summary receiver operating characteristic regression models were used to compute the pooled sensitivity and specificity applying different test cut-offs for outcomes of high-grade CIN.Main results Thirty-two papers comprising 7873 paired punch/ definitive histology results were identified. The pooled sensitivity for a punch biopsy defined as test cut-off CIN1+ to diagnose CIN2+ disease was 91.3% (95% CI 85.3-94.9%) and the specificity was 24.6% (95% CI 16.0-35.9%). In most of the studies, the majority of enrolled women had positive punch biopsies. Pooling of the four studies where the excision biopsy was performed immediately after the punch biopsy, and where the rate of positive punch biopsies was considerably lower, yielded a sensitivity of 81.4% and specificity of 63.3%.Author's conclusion The observed high sensitivity of the punch biopsy derived from all studies is probably the result of verification bias.
Introduction A shift in focus towards risk stratification and survivorship in early stage endometrial cancer (EC) has led to the replacement of hospital follow‐up (HFU) with patient‐initiated follow‐up (PIFU) schemes. Methods A mixed methods study was undertaken prospectively to investigate utility and patient satisfaction with a newly introduced PIFU scheme. Results Two hundred and twenty‐eight women were enrolled onto PIFU in the first 18 months, median age 65 years (range 42–90 years). Twenty‐four (10.5%) women were non‐British White ethnicity. Forty‐five women contacted the Clinical Nurse Specialist (CNS) at least once (19.7%), the primary reason being vaginal bleeding/discharge (42%). Contact was greater in first six months on the scheme compared to the second 6 months, and women who made contact were significantly younger than those who did not (57 years vs. 65 years, p < 0.001). Conclusions PIFU appears to be well received by the majority of women. Although many of the CNS contacts were due to physical symptoms, a number were for psychological support or reassurance. Younger women had greater CNS contact indicating that they may benefit from a greater level support. Patient feedback of the PIFU scheme was positive, with many women reporting that it enabled them to have more control over their own health.
ACCEPTED MANUSCRIPT ABSTRACTCervical cancer is the fourth most common cancer in women worldwide (WHO, 2016). In many developed countries the incidence of cervical cancer has been significantly reduced by the introduction of organised screening programmes however, in the UK, a fall in screening coverage is becoming a cause for concern. Much research attention has been afforded to younger women but age stratified mortality and incidence data suggest that older women's screening attendance is also worthy of study. Real-time quantitative RT-PCR (qRT-PCR) is a powerful technique used for the relative quantification of target genes, using reference (housekeeping) genes for normalization to ensure the generation of accurate and robust data. A systematic examination of the suitability of endogenous reference genes for gene expression studies in endometrial cancer tissues is absent. The aims of this study were therefore to identify and evaluate from the thirty-two possible reference genes from a TaqMan(®) array panel their suitability as an internal control gene. The mathematical software packages geNorm qBasePLUS identified Pumilio homolog 1 (Drosophila) (PUM1), ubiquitin C (UBC), phosphoglycerate kinase (PGK1), mitochondrial ribosomal protein L19 (MRPL19) and peptidylpropyl isomerase A (cyclophilin A) (PPIA) as the best reference gene combination, whilst NormFinder identified MRPL19 as the best single reference gene, with importin 8 (IPO8) and PPIA being the best combination of two reference genes. BestKeeper ranked MRPL19 as the most stably expressed gene. In addition, the study was validated by examining the relative expression of a test gene, which encodes the cannabinoid receptor 1 (CB1). A significant difference in CB1 mRNA expression between malignant and normal endometrium using MRPL19, PPIA, and IP08 in combination was observed. The use of MRPL19, IPO8 and PPIA was identified as the best reference gene combination for the normalization of gene expression levels in endometrial carcinoma. This study demonstrates that the arbitrary selection of endogenous control reference genes for normalization in qRT-PCR studies of endometrial carcinoma, without validation, risks the production of inaccurate data and should therefore be discouraged.
